2022 Arizona Baseball Promo Schedule & Ticket Packs

TUCSON, Ariz. — Get your "Ticket to the Show" and come experience all of the fun promotions and ticket packs that 2022 Arizona Baseball team has planned this season.

Detailed information on all of the promotions and ticket packs available during the Wildcats 2022 season can be found below.

Season Long Promotions

  • $2 Tuesdays: For any Tuesday game this season, fans can purchase select items for $2 during the game.
  • Trading Card Giveaway: Be sure to collect all 11 trading cards that include current members of the 2022 season.
  • Camper Reunions: We have 3 dates scheduled where we will invite campers to a game. All Arizona Baseball Campers will be able to purchase $4 ticket once they receive an email with instructions on how to purchase their discounted tickets
    • Dates:
      • Wisconsin-Milwaukee | Friday, February 25
      • Texas State | Sunday, March 6
      • Stanford | Sunday, March 20
  • Postgame Catch on the Field: Following the games below kids can play catch on the field with a friend or family member.
    • Dates:
      • Wisconsin-Milwaukee | Friday, February 25
      • Texas State | Saturday, March 5
      • Stanford | Sunday, March 20
      • Arizona State | Friday, April 22
      • Oregon State | Saturday, May 14
  • Concession Promotions: Throughout the season, concession stands at Hi Corbett will offer various items on special days for fans to enjoy:
    • National Chili Day – Thursday, February 24 (Wisconsin-Milwaukee)
    • National Oreo Cookie Day – Sunday, March 6 (Texas State)
    • Pretzel Day – Friday, March 25 (UCLA)
    • Apple Pie Day – Friday, May 13 (Oregon State)
  • Sunday Fun Day: Following each Sunday game kids can run the bases, except when there is a postgame catch on the field is scheduled.

Single Game Promotions

  • 2012 National Championship Celebration: Join us as we honor and celebrate the 10-year anniversary of the 2012 National Championship on Saturday, March 19.
  • Car Show at Hi Corbett: Come check out the different muscle and sport cars before the game versus Stanford on Sunday, March 20 at 8 a.m. The first 500 fans attending the game, will receive an Arizona Baseball toy car.
  • Bark at the Park: Bring your furry best friend out to Hi Corbett on Sunday, March 27 when Cats host Bark at the Park. All pets get in free, but must be on leash.
  • Military Appreciation Weekend: Military Appreciation weekend will be during the Washington State series (April 8-10) this season. Join us all weekend long as we recognize and honor our current and former members of the military.
  • First Responder Appreciation Weekend: First Responder Appreciation weekend will be during the Nevada series (April 28-30) this season. Join us all weekend long as we recognize and honor our current and former members of first responders.
  • Giveaways:
    • Arizona Baseball Red Jersey Koozie (Friday, March 4 vs Texas State)
    • 2012 National Championship Banner (Saturday, March 19 vs Stanford)
    • Arizona Baseball Toy Car (Sunday, March 20 vs Stanford)
    • Jason Donald Bobblehead (Saturday, March 26 vs UCLA)
    • Pet Bandana (Sunday, March 27 vs UCLA)
    • Team Photo Poster (Saturday, May 14 vs Oregon State)

Ticket Packages

  • 10-Game Flex Pass: For $70 you can get 10 General Admission tickets and use them however you choose. You may use all 10 tickets to one game or 1 ticket to 10 of the 31 home dates.
  • Family 4 Pack: Bring your family out to a game for only $44 and receive 4 General Admission tickets and 4 food vouchers (Hot Dog and 16 oz. drink).
  • Birthday at the Ballpark (Package available for youth 12 and under only): Spend your birthday at Hi Corbett starting at $175 dollars and receive 15 General Admission tickets, 15 food vouchers (hot dog, chips and 16 oz. drink), an autograph poster for birthday kid, name on the video board and opportunity to stand on the field for the National Anthem.
